Mobility scooters give their users convenience and freedom. Like any other piece of machinery, they are prone to breakdowns. Many of these issues can be avoided by following a few easy preventative maintenance tips.

The motor, battery and tyres are the primary areas that need regular attention. The motor is the most expensive component of your mobility scooter and it will require a maintenance by a certified professional every year at the minimum to ensure that it's in good working order. It is crucial to charge your battery on a regular basis and not leave it charging for too long. This could reduce the battery's lifespan.

Tyres on a mobility scooter are usually solid or pneumatic and require regular inspection for signs of wear and tear. If you notice that your tyres have become damaged, it is best to replace them before they get punctured as this could be dangerous.

If your tyres have a leak or are flat, the valves or sidewalls could be damaged. To avoid a puncture, you need to replace your tyres soon as possible.

You should also check your brakes regularly for signs of wear and tear. If your brakes are beginning to slide, it's a good idea to replace them as soon as you can to avoid a serious accident.


It's also a good idea after each use you clean your scooter down to remove any dirt or debris. This will keep you safe from future problems such as rust. You should also try to avoid putting too much moisture from the device by not driving through puddles as this could cause the formation of rust on side of the scooter.

The wear and tear that comes with daily usage of a mobility scooter can be a burden, and sometimes your vehicle will require repairs. Regular maintenance by a qualified professional will help prevent damage and keep your scooter in top shape.

Top Tip: Check the battery regularly. Batteries age over time and therefore keeping them top up can help extend their lifespan and improve performance. To get the best results, batteries should be charged overnight.

Low battery may be the reason for your mobility scooter hesitant to run when you push the throttle. It is essential to get it checked as soon as you can. It could be required to be replaced entirely or have an upgrade charger installed to restore the power.

The scooter may also pause when it is on an inclined slope. Many scooters can be used on slopes but they'll run at a slower speed or maybe not at all if the slope is steep.

Keep your mobility scooter clean by wiping it clean after every journey. This will shield it from moisture which could cause corrosion. Avoid driving through puddles if are able, as they could cause water damage to the underside of the scooter, and could cause electrical issues. A mobility scooter, as any other vehicle can benefit from regular maintenance. This will ensure that it performs at its highest level. The motor, battery, and tires are the main components of a mobility vehicle that require regular maintenance. The steering wheels, the wheels and brakes, which are all important safety features, should also be monitored regularly to ensure they are not damaged or worn out. Consult the manual of your scooter for detailed maintenance and care instructions.

The battery is the primary source of power for a mobility scooter and it is important to keep it in good shape to avoid the possibility of damage or loss in functionality. You should always charge the battery of your mobility scooter for at about 8-10 hours at a stretch. Also, avoid storing the scooter in temperatures that are cold or humid. This could cause damage to your battery and other components.
